NHL Nears Olympic Pause With Goalie Questions and Trade Postures Taking Shape

The Olympic pause on Feb. 5 forces last‑minute evaluations ahead of the March 6 trade deadline.

Overview

  • League play stops after Feb. 5 for MilanCortina, with a roster freeze in effect until games resume later in February.
  • Edmonton’s instability in net persisted when Tristan Jarry was pulled on Jan. 31 after five goals on 20 shots, even as Connor McDavid sits at 95 points through 56 games.
  • Carolina’s rookie Brandon Bussi has surged to roughly 20 wins with Pyotr Kochetkov out for the season, and the club is reported to be targeting a high‑end second‑line center.
  • Calgary signaled a sell direction after moving Rasmus Andersson to Vegas, and reports say the Flames are fielding calls on Nazem Kadri and injured Blake Coleman.
  • Winnipeg is being characterized in reports as a likely seller, with veterans drawing interest as blue line injuries strain an already struggling group.
